Afua Hirsch

Afua Hirsch is a former barrister, award-winning journalist, broadcaster and human rights campaigner. She regularly writes for the Guardian and Observer newspapers, moderates corporate seminars and plenary sessions, speaks at conferences, and delivers keynote speeches on diversity and inclusion, social justice, anti-racism, identity, unconscious bias and the media. She was raised in Wimbledon, a testing ground for her observations about the divisions in modern Britain; London is one of the most diverse cities in the world, yet the privileged, hillside enclave, where Afua grew up was almost exclusively white. From a young age, she had to make sense of the ways in which people racialised her - a mixed-race, black girl with an African name and a middle class upbringing - while at the same time claiming that they "did not see race". Afua had to work out for herself the history of where those ideas originated, and why that history has shaped our world in so many profound ways, addressing it rarely and in the most selective ways. Afua Hirsch left school in 1999 and studied philosophy, politics and economics at St Peter's College, University of Oxford. There she focused on African politics and wrote a thesis on how the traditional role of women in Ghanaian society had shaped postcolonial contemporary national politics. After graduating in 2002 with a degree in politics and a law degree, Afua qualified as a barrister in 2006 at the Bar of England and Wales, and trained at Doughty Street Chambers. A chamber which has pioneered advocacy and jurisprudence on human rights in England and Wales, and around the world. There, she practiced human rights law in criminal defence, public and international law before realising that, ultimately, what she really wanted, was to communicate the importance of these struggles to a wider audience. And so she turned her focus to journalism. In 2008, Afua Hirsch became the legal affairs correspondent for the Guardian Newspaper. Then in 2011, she moved to Ghana as the Guardian's West Africa correspondent, covering a large part of West and Central Africa for the newspaper. Having moved back to the UK several years later, Afua began making TV in earnest in 2014 when she joined Sky News as the Social Affairs editor, a position she held until 2017. She reported on stories ranging from the return of slums in the UK's deteriorating private rental sector, to the girl born into and trapped in a cult until her 30's. She is currently a regular contributor to Sky News debate show The Pledge, and participates in other current affairs programmes including C4 News, BBC2 Newsnight, BBC1 Question Time, and CNN. Afua also writes feature length articles for publications ranging from Time Magazine, Vogue, the Sunday Times and the Observer. Afua Hirsch is a Booker Prize judge, the world's leading literary prize for works of fiction in the English language. She is also one half of the fashion brand Sika, which creates ethically-made, African inspired men's and women's wear clothing, made in Ghana, sold globally. Her first published book, released in 2018, Brit(ish): On Race, Identity And Belonging was awarded a Royal Society of Literature Jerwood Prize for Non-Fiction and is an Amazon best-seller. In October 2020, Afua co-presented Enslaved: The Lost History of the Transatlantic Slave Trade alongside Hollywood movie icon and human rights activist Samuel L Jackson. Enslaved is a critically acclaimed and groundbreaking six-part documentary about the transatlantic slave trade, which aired on BBC2 and shone a light on 400-years of human trafficking and the millions of Africans who were shipped to the Americas. Alex Macqueen

Job Titles:
  • BAFTA Nominated Actor Best Known for the Thick of It and the Inbetweeners
Alex Macqueen is a BAFTA nominated actor and qualified Barrister. He is best known for his roles as Julius Nicholson in the BBC's 'Thick Of It' and Neil's Dad in the Channel 4 comedy 'The Inbetweeners'. He is a very experienced and engaging speaker, sharing anecdotes from the world of film and TV, as well as insights from his experience as a Barrister and Master of the Bench, at London's Middle Temple. He has chaired the 'Downing Street Debates' at Number 10 and hosted conferences and awards including the ULTRA Travel Awards, Simpsons Healthcare conference and the Middle Temple Annual Dinner. He is in demand as an entertaining after dinner speaker, both for the legal profession and audiences who like to hear what really goes on backstage in the theatre, on film sets and in court. He has a long association working with Sir Kenneth Branagh, which began when he was directed by him in Disney's 'Cinderella', before going on to star opposite him in the West End version of 'The Painkiller', and the Sony Classic movie, 'All Is True'. Most recently, he starred opposite Hugh Bonneville in the 'Downton Abbey: A New Era', Will Ferrell in Jesse Armstrong's 'Downhill' and Michael Caine in Paolo Sorrentino's 'Youth'. He was nominated for a BAFTA for the HBO comedy, 'Sally4Ever' and an Evening Standard Award for the Film 4 thriller, 'The Hide'. He's also appeared in family favourites, The Durrells, Outnumbered, Miranda, Peaky Blinders, The IT Crowd, Black Mirror and This Is England… to name but a few. Andrew McMillan

Job Titles:
  • Customer Service and Experience Expert
Andrew McMillan spent 28 years with John Lewis Department Stores, the last eight of which he was responsible for customer experience across the department store division. That customer experience culture is something that has now became synonymous with the John Lewis brand. Andrew started his career as a management trainee with the John Lewis Partnership at Brent Cross. He quickly moved up through the management ranks and led a number of selling teams in different branches culminating in managing the furniture floor in the flagship Oxford Street branch. From there he moved to the head office to take charge of the department stores' customer-centric Intelligence Team. They acted as an internal business consultancy reporting on competitive strategy, product differentiation and value, catchment area demographics for new branches and customer service. In 2000, Andrew McMillan was asked to lead on customer service for the department store division. The role saw him develop JLP's market-leading culture and attitude towards customer service and sales with the 20,000 customer-facing Partners in 26 John Lewis shops across the UK. During his tenure, JLP won awards for customer service from Which?, Verdict and Retail Week and were frequently cited in the media as a leading customer oriented organisation. Andrew was also responsible for the management and resolution of the group's escalated customer complaints. While at John Lewis, Andrew advised many other non-competing organisations on their customer service strategy and became recognised as an expert in the field. Andrew McMillan joined the Customer Experience Committee at the British Council of Shopping Centres during his time at John Lewis; he was asked the Chair the committee in 2010. This role maintains Andrew's strong links with the retail community, where he has a particular interest in promoting the viability of the UK's shopping centres and High Streets as valuable social spaces in addition to the commercial benefits they bring. During Andrew's chairmanship the committee developed and grew the awards substantially to well over 100 shopping centre entrants which has raised the profile and importance of customer experience in the retail property sector. Andrew McMillan speaks at conferences and seminars worldwide, and across all business sectors, as well as local government, health and not-for-profit. In presentations, he explains that great customer experience cannot be taught but reflects a great internal culture. By developing a personality and values that are realistic, honest, and shared, organisations can deliver a degree of long lasting, competitive differentiation that few achieve, but many aspire to. Content for Andrew's speeches is created collaboratively and tailored to the exact requirements of your event, so no two presentations are ever identical. Along with stories and examples from his extensive experience, presentations also include practical solutions that can be implemented quickly and with minimal cost. Azeem Rafiq

Job Titles:
  • British Asian County Cricketer. Author of ‘It's Not Banter, It 's Racism
Azeem Rafiq is a British Asian cricketer who played professionally for Yorkshire County Cricket Club (YCCC), Derbyshire County Cricket Club, and Lincolnshire County Cricket Club, making his senior debut at the age of just 17 and captained the England under-15 and under-19 sides. In 2012, he became the youngest man to captain a Yorkshire side as well as the first person of Asian origin to do so. In 2018, Azeem's world changed forever. He lost his baby son, and soon after he also lost the career that he had worked his entire life for. While at YCCC, Azeem suffered racism and bullying and it took him many years to fully understand the impact of his suffering, particularly his treatment by the club during a very difficult time. In 2020, he spoke out about the discrimination that not only he faced but discrimination across the game and took legal action against the club hoping to create change across the sport. His brave actions forced an overhaul of the toxic culture and behaviour both present at YCCC and in the sport more widely. As a consequence, several other cricketers have felt empowered to come forward with their experiences of discrimination. Azeem hopes that future generations of aspiring cricketers will be able to play the game they love without fear of humiliation. A Cricket Discipline Commission proved charges Azeem led and have brought the game into disrepute through their clear use of racist and discriminatory language. For Azeem, this experience was about confronting the institutionalised racism that's been going on for decades in English Cricket and starting to promote change in a community that is very naïve and hesitant to change. Azeem is keen to use his experience to help society to understand the lived experience and impact of conscious and unconscious bias, as well as having a renewed purpose and mission to campaign for a meaningful change in global sport. Rafiq has entered a new and exciting chapter and has authored his book "It's Not Banter, It's Racism: What Cricket's Dirty Secret Reveals About Our Society". Ben Collins

Job Titles:
  • Expert
Ben Collins is an expert on driving and the mental aptitude required to be a professional. He is able to communicate what it feels like to race, where split-second timing, high pressure and total focus are key, and then to adapt these skills to the challenges of everyday life. His strength of character was revealed very early on, when as a child his family moved to America and he was enrolled into a local swimming team. His competitive nature drove him to nationwide competition and a gruelling training regime of 30 hours a week by the age of 7. Winning was etched into his ethos and the determination to succeed has remained a constant throughout his life. Ben Collins understands the corporate world well, and as Brand Manager for Hornby Scalextric for several years, he was responsible for a significant upturn in sales. Ben spends a great deal of time hosting corporate events and track days and is sensitive to the complexities of the business world. Ben Collins is continually in demand as an after dinner speaker and motivational speaker due to his unique career and continuing success. His entertaining anecdotes and tales of incredible stunts make for a truly unique experience, with a story of strong commitment and an iron will that has helped establish Ben as a world class performer. Ben Collins has a wealth of stories from his eight years as Top Gear's The Stig, from coaching the likes of Tom Cruise, Ellen MacArthur, Gordon Ramsay and Cameron Diaz to organised high voltage car chases and testing hundreds of priceless cars. Clive Coleman

Clive Coleman is the BBC's Legal Correspondent, a role he arrived at via a career as a barrister, Principal Lecturer in Law, and then one of the country's leading comedy writers. He works across television news and radio, appearing regularly on the Today programme, Five Live, Breakfast, The News Channel and BBC news bulletins.For six years from 2004-2010 he presented the BBC's flagship legal analysis programme 'Law In Action' on Radio 4, a role for which, in 2009, he won the Bar Council's Legal Broadcasting Award. Clive has presented many other television and radio programmes for the BBC including Panorama (BBC1), Profile (R4), Pick of the Week (R4), The Cases That Changed Our World (R4). Clive Coleman began his career as a barrister in 1986 at the chambers of Robin Stewart QC at 2 Harcourt Buildings, Temple. Working in both crime and civil law, for prosecution and defence, his career started in spectacular fashion when he managed to get his first client off with a mere six-month prison sentence. That was for a parking offence, though, to be fair, he had just parked on top of his social worker! So, it's perhaps not surprising that he saw the funny side of life in court and wanted to write about it. His television credits include: 'Dead Ringers', 'Spitting Image', 'Smith and Jones' and 'Chambers' his hit BBC1 sit-com about barristers, starring John Bird, James Fleet and Sarah Lancashire. He's also written a huge amount of comedy for Radio with credits including, 'Weekending', 'The News Huddlines' and his sit-com 'Spending My Inheritance', starring Kris Marshall. Clive Coleman's also written television drama for the ITV series 'The Bill' (for whom he has also acted as a legal consultant on court based story lines). In 1992, Clive Coleman won the prestigious BBC Radio Light Entertainment Contract Writers Award. In 1998 he won the BBC's inaugural 'Frank Muir Award', for outstanding comedy writing. He has also written regularly on 'The Times' comment pages and for 'The Guardian' and 'The Independent'. Clive Coleman has delivered keynote and after dinner speeches to an array of UK based and multinational companies, trade and professional bodies. Not restricted by any means to the legal profession, Clive's after dinner speech will delight audiences from all professions and walks of life - offering a hilarious and unique perspective on the quirkiness of the world in which we live today. Colin Maclachlan

Colin Maclachlan spent nearly 17 years in the military, the latter half with UK Special Forces (Mountain Troop, 22 SAS). During his time in the Special Forces he held various roles from Sniper Commander, Driver Commander, Instructor on Selection Training Wing, Surveillance Operator, Forward Air Controller, Medic, Bodyguard, SF Exchange Programme with Delta Force and Seal Team 6. He left the SAS in 2006 after his high profile capture and subsequent rescue in Iraq. Since then he has been involved in bodyguarding the likes of the Saudi Royal Family, ‘A List' Celebrities and large news networks. Colin holds an MA (Hons) in History from Edinburgh University and an M.Litt. in Terrorism from St. Andrews. He currently writes articles and commentates on military and terrorism related topics. Colin Maclachlan was involved in some of the most successful and high profile operations in the SAS's recent history. More recently, he has been involved in the highly acclaimed Channel 4 series SAS: WHO DARES WINS and has appeared on several TV and Radio shows as well as writing many pieces for national newspapers. Colin has also been undertaking motion capture work and consultancy for video games such as Rockstar Games and is credited on Grand Theft Auto III, IV, and V, Red Dead Redemption and LA Noire. He is involved in a number of charities including being a Patron for the Lee Rigby Foundation, Ambassador for the Pilgrims Charity, Help for Heroes and many more.
